Model Information

3197 Tris
1024 x 1024 Texture
Trim: Low Floor 40' Hybrid Bus

Original Model[3dwarehouse.sketchup.com] Reduced polys, made the front part more round to actually fit with the Gillig BRT Template, added hybrid backing from Gillig Low Floor Hybrid bus I released, Retextured, remapped, and converted for Cities Skylines.

Stats are the same as the default bus.
